Editorial Cartoons

- It is a newspaper visual information on the political and social issues of our society. (pictorial/caricature form)

Page 3: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

• It is a permanent feature of the editorial page

Page 4: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

• It is called a “wordless editorial”

Page 5: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

- It expresses comments on a current issue and seeks to influence public opinion.

Page 6: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

• It provides humor and lightness that break the

seriousness of the accompanying opinion.

Page 7: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

- It makes the character or an event interesting and entertaining

Page 8: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Editorial Cartoons

- Emphasize a single point and topic.

Subjects/Topics in Cartooning

• Political – government – relationship of people and leaders & among leaders

• Social – interaction among people

• Culture – enlightenment or civilization

• History – past events• Economics –

business, production and consumption of goods and services

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

Page 12: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

1. Use bold lines and strokes

Page 13: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

2. It should have one/single topic

Page 14: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

3. A clear, catchy, attractive and striking cartoon is necessary.

Page 15: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

4. Consider your readers in the choice of symbols.

Page 16: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

5. Develop your own style. Watch out for plagiarism.

Page 17: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

6. Cartoons are also subject to the laws of libel.

Page 18: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:7. In depicting human figures, use the various geometric shapes. (Round, Oblong, Square, Oval)

Page 19: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:8. Look for distinguishing features which

will enable the reader to recognize your subject such as: a bald head, bullying eyes, slit eyes, thick eye brows/or thin, dimples, sunken cheeks or a very sharp nose.

Page 20: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

9.Study lines to show basic facial expressions or emotions.

Page 21: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:10. The cartoonist should be open to

ideas, confer with the editor and other

staff.

Page 22: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Drawing Tips for the Cartoonist:

11. Don’t forget to show dynamic action on your cartoons.

Page 23: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Steps in Editorial Cartooning

• List down the subjects to choose from.

• Think of the propelling current issue.

• Ask what is the opinion/stand of the paper about the issue.

Page 24: Journ Training-Editorial Cartoon

Steps in Editorial Cartooning

• Decide the universal symbols to be used.

• Draw more than one cartoon/caricature on the same subject/issue chosen.

• Finally choose the best editorial cartooning to be printed.
